Consulate Remembers Suffrage Movement
September 2, 2008

In honor of the 88th anniversary of the approval of the 19th Amendment to the U.S. Constitution, which granted women in the United States the right to vote, the U.S. Consulate General and the Centro Ecuatoriano-Norteamericano (CEN) sponsored a roundtable discussion of issues relating to gender in politics and society.
The panelists participating in the roundtable were prominent American and Ecuadorian women who are living examples of the advances that women have made in the past century. The Political and Economic Officer, Vistazo Magazine Editor Patricia Estupiñan and CEN Director General Susana Cepeda each shared their experiences with approximately 170 students from the CEN.
The Consulate’s Public Affairs Officer served as the moderator of the forum, which was conducted completely in English to help the students increase and improve their English skills.
